מַגְפִּיעָ֥שׁ | Magpiash |
Parse: Proper Noun, masculine singular Root: מַגְפִּיעָשׁ Sense: one of the chiefs of the people who signed the covenant with Nehemiah. |
|
מְשֻׁלָּ֖ם | Meshullam |
Parse: Proper Noun, masculine singular Root: מְשֻׁלָּם Sense: grandfather of Shaphan, the scribe. 2 son of Zerubbabel. 3 a Benjamite of the sons of Elpaal. 4 a Benjamite, father of Sallu. 5 a Benjamite who lived at Jerusalem after the captivity. 6 a Benjamite. 6a perhaps the same as 3 or 4. 7 a Gadite in the reign of king Jotham of Judah. 8 son of Berechiah who assisted in rebuilding the wall of Jerusalem. 9 son of Besodeiah who assisted Jehoiada the son of Paseah in restoring the old gate of Jerusalem. 0 a chief of the people who sealed the covenant with Nehemiah. father of Hilkiah and high priest probably in the reign of king Amon of Judah. |
|
חֵזִֽיר | Hezir |
Parse: Proper Noun, masculine singular Root: חֵזִיר Sense: a priest in the time of David, leader of the 7th monthly course. |
